释义 | ˈknuckle-ˌjoint 1. lit. Each joint of the knuckles (of the hands), or the joint of the leg of an animal called a knuckle. 2. Mech. A joint or coupling forming a connexion between two parts of a mechanism, in which a projection in one is inserted into a corresponding recess in the other (like the knuckles of the two hands when clasped or placed together); also extended to other joints, such as universal joints.
